| | | Re: Ashurst The camp site at ashurst has a Quiet area and a Rowdy area ask at the reception centre try not to get put by the railway embankment
That said there were plenty of Dragonflies a big pub with a garden for children and really loads to see.The reptile centre was v.good and there was a Raptor camera close by to watch Goshawk chicks?
